  • Patent number: 6601501
    Abstract: A paper discharging apparatus, which is provided in a printing machine, for transferring sheets of paper having different thickness. The paper discharging apparatus has a first gripper unit fixed in a groove, which extends along the cylindrical surface of a printing cylinder, and a second gripper unit, which moves along a discharging rail. The second gripper unit has a gripper and a base to hold the sheet. The position of the base is adjusted in accordance with the thickness of the sheet. A relatively thin sheet of paper is held by the first gripper unit and a relatively thick sheet of paper is held by the second gripper unit.

  • Patent number: 5906158
    Abstract: A screen printing apparatus in which alignment marks are provided on the screen and the printing material. The marks are detected accurately and clearly by an alignment mark detector located between the printing material and the screen.
